19] studied plasma nitriding of 17-4PH martensitic stainless steel and found almost the same results found by Li et al. [18]. They applied the following conditions: temperatures of 350, 370, 390, 420, 460, and 500 °C, atmosphere of 25 % N2 + 75 % H2, pressure of 500 Pa, and durations of 10, 20 and 30 h. For samples nitrided under 420 °C, a bright layer was observed. This was due not to have been attacked by etchant solution. However, the upper part of the layer treated at 420 °C for 20 h was slightly etched, indicating the nitrides precipitation during the treatment.
